State Medical Officer, State Mental Health Institute, Dr. Viketoulie Pienyii has suggested that government should enact law to stop abuse, exploitation, corruption, etc, and also advised youths to be vigilant and remain alert to develop a strong accountability system.
A press release by District Field Coordinator, NFI, Vekulu Demo stated that Dr. Viketoulie made this suggestion while speaking as resource person at the seminar on SDG Goal 16: Peace, Justice and Strong Institution on January 24, at the office of ARK Foundation, Kohima organised by National Foundation for India (NFI).
He also lamented about crimes committed against children and women, corruption, injustice, inequality, unemployment, climatic change etc. According to Dr. Viketoulie, all such social elements results in serious repercussions in the larger society.
He therefore, emphasized the need to transfer investment from upper section to less privileged section.
He noted that this could create balance in various classes prevailing within society.
He further challenged the youths to take up issues which would lead to sustainable life in future.
The objective of the seminar was to create awareness to youths on how to promote peace and generate an inclusive society for sustainable development.
Highlighting the background of the programme, District Field Coordinator, NFI, Vekulu Demo, delivered an overview of the project initiated by NFI towards SDG Goal 16 since July 2021.
She stated that the programme aimed to empower the youths on importance of peace, justice and strong institution, and how to resolve conflicts among various and numerous social groups.
